Our Verdict

The AVAHUM 120-pint dehumidifier delivers serious moisture removal power. It pulls 120 pints per day and covers up to 5500 square feet.

You get a built-in pump with a 16.4-foot drain hose. This means true hands-free drainage without gravity setups.

The auto-defrost works down to 41°F. That makes it a strong pick for cold crawl spaces and unheated basements.

At $395, you pay about $3.29 per pint of daily capacity. Most commercial units at this capacity cost $500 or more.

The relocatable touch panel is a nice touch. You can mount the controls where you can actually reach them.

This unit weighs 60 pounds and has no wheels. Moving it around takes real effort.

You will not find Wi-Fi or app control here. If you want remote monitoring, look elsewhere.

For crawl spaces, basements, and commercial jobs, this unit hits the mark. It focuses on raw dehumidification power at a competitive price.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ions aboutCrawl Space Dehumidifier 120 Pint Commercial Dehumidifier for Basement,Whole House with Drain Hose,Energy Efficient Dehumidifiers, Water Damage Unit, Auto Defrost

How large of a space can this dehumidifier handle?

The AVAHUM dehumidifier covers up to 5500 square feet. It removes 120 pints of moisture per day with 230 CFM airflow. This makes it suitable for large basements, crawl spaces, and commercial areas.

Does this dehumidifier have a built-in pump for drainage?

Yes. It has a built-in pump that automatically drains collected water. The package includes a 16.4-foot drain hose. The pump starts on its own when the internal tank fills up.

Can this unit work in cold crawl spaces?

Yes. It operates in temperatures from 41°F to 94°F. The auto-defrost cycle activates when frost forms on the coils. Epoxy-coated coils also resist corrosion in damp conditions.

How do you control the humidity settings?

You use the touch panel on the unit. The humidity range is adjustable from 10% to 98%. You can also buy a 33-inch extension cord to relocate the touch panel to a more convenient spot.

Does this dehumidifier have wheels?

No. This unit does not have wheels. It weighs 60 pounds and has a ridged carry handle. It also has 4 leveling feet and can be hung from joists using a hanging kit.
